I just feel the need today to blog about the top 10 things I love about real estate.  I am sitting here in the aisle of our church sanctuary watching my daughter dress rehearse for her weekend performance, and enjoying my wireless (yet again!).

I'll go backward in true Letterman style:

10-I can update my files while eating ice cream and sitting on the floor!

9--I can market my listings in the middle of the night, giving new meaning to flex hours:-)

8--I was at my son's Special Olympics Torch Run today, when most were working, discussing strategy with my Team Leader!  We really do have great tools----

7--I told my husband I needed a new laptop with tablet that would fit in my purse, so I could take it with me everywhere---and he bought it for me (I love you honey:-))!

6--Commission checks ROCK!

5--I get to go into the most fantastic homes, and NO ONE assumes I am burglerizing!  And I'm not, so it's all good.

4--Did I mention that commission checks ROCK!

3--Passive income through referrals.  Having a lazy week?  No issues--refer away!

2--I can write off my mileage and gasoline expenses--for the most part!  Love that!

AND THE NUMBER ONE REASON----

1--I always have a reason to start talking to total strangers!  And they always have something new to chat with me about!  AND--I call that prospecting, and so does my Team Leader (does that mean I can write off my gym membership?)

But really, I do love what I do, and I hope it shows.  As I have never known another type of market--this one is working for me, and successfully.  So, I am joyful and it is good!  Just thought I'd share.  Now, check out my new One Team-Keller Williams First Coast fan page on Facebook and let me know your thoughts!
